CVE-2022-23451: Incorrect Authorization

September 7, 2022 (updated September 15, 2022)

An authorization flaw was found in openstack-barbican. The default policy rules for the secret metadata API allowed any authenticated user to add, modify, or delete metadata from any secret regardless of ownership. This flaw allows an attacker on the network to modify or delete protected data, causing a denial of service by consuming protected resources.

Affected versions

All versions before 14.0.0

Fixed versions

  • 14.0.0

Solution

Upgrade to version 14.0.0 or above.

Impact 8.1 HIGH

C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:U/C:N/I:H/A:H
